Senior Animator
Join Critical Path Games in Burnaby, BC as a full‑time Senior Animator. You will be part of a small, on‑site team delivering a new AAA dark‑fantasy title. We require a deep understanding of animation that drives gameplay and will help shape the visual and mechanical feel of the game.
Responsibilities- Drive an iterative animation pipeline, owning animations from concept to in‑engine implementation.
- Champion a "playable early" philosophy by delivering rapid rough block‑outs for immediate testing, then refining to final polish.
- Define combat feel & responsiveness, working closely with the team to establish melee mechanics that balance strict gameplay requirements (frame data, cancel windows, active hit frames).
- Execute stylized believability, creating high‑quality character and weapon animations that convey physical weight, momentum, and anticipation in fast‑paced action.
- 10+ years as an animator in the games industry with at least one shipped AAA or high‑profile title featuring complex character mechanics.
- Deep understanding of "Game Feel" and how animation supports gameplay (cancel windows, hit pauses, blending, attack combo flow).
- 3D software proficiency, primarily in Blender (experience with Maya, Motion Builder, or Blender accepted). Willingness to learn Blender‑based pipeline.
- Engine & implementation experience in Unreal, Unity, or a proprietary engine, with proven ability to implement animations, tweak blend spaces, and troubleshoot logic.
- Collaborative mindset: thrive in an environment where all disciplines work together to solve problems.

Compensation is set by seniority and is non‑negotiable, reflecting fairness and transparency. Mid‑Developer levels (5–10 years) receive $131,250 CAD per year. Senior Developers (10+ years) receive $157,500 CAD per year. All employees are entitled to participate in the Company’s Equity Incentive Plan.
Location:
Burnaby, BC – on‑site only. Candidates must be able to commute reliably or relocate before starting work. Remote or hybrid setups will not be considered.
